About
Lake Shore Bancorp is the publicly traded holding company of Lake Shore Bank, a locally operated commercial bank serving individuals and businesses in Western New York. The bank provides retail and commercial lending, deposit products, treasury-management services, and personal banking through branches across Chautauqua and Erie counties. Its operating mission emphasizes personal customer service, lasting relationships, community financial needs, sound banking practices, and support for customers’ financial goals.
